Nextiva

Software Engineer, Java

Nextiva

full-time

Posted on:

Location Type: Hybrid

Location: Bangalore • 🇮🇳 India

Visit company website
AI Apply
Apply

Job Level

Mid-LevelSenior

Tech Stack

AWSAzureCloudDistributed SystemsDockerGoogle Cloud PlatformJavaKubernetesMicroservicesMySQLPostgresRedisSpringSpring BootSpringBootSQL

About the role

  • Design, develop, and maintain backend services and APIs
  • Collaborate with frontend and mobile teams to deliver end-to-end solutions
  • Optimize application performance and scalability
  • Write clean, well-structured, and maintainable code
  • Participate in code reviews and provide constructive feedback
  • Identify and implement process improvements
  • Mentor and guide junior engineers

Requirements

  • 4+ years of experience in building Java, Springboot, Microservices based applications from scratch.
  • Expertise in building RESTful web applications using Java 8+ and Spring Framework
  • Excellent in writing loosely coupled code in Java, Spring, Springboot, Service Oriented Architecture ( SOA ) designs/ Microservices.
  • Strong proficiency in SQL and experience with databases like MySQL and Postgres
  • Familiarity with caching solutions like Redis
  • Solid understanding of system design principles and architecture
  • Experience with distributed systems is a plus
  • In-depth knowledge of modern software development methodologies (Agile, DevOps)
  • Knowledge of cloud platforms (AWS, GCP, Azure), Docker, and Kubernetes is a plus
  • Strong problem-solving and debugging skills
  • Excellent communication and collaboration skills
Benefits
  • Medical 🩺 - Medical insurance coverage is available for employees, their spouse, and up to two dependent children with a limit of 500,000 INR, as well as their parents or in-laws for up to 300,000 INR. This comprehensive coverage ensures that essential healthcare needs are met for the entire family unit, providing peace of mind and security in times of medical necessity.
  • Group Term & Group Personal Accident Insurance 💼 - Provides insurance coverage against the risk of death / injury during the policy period sustained due to an accident caused by violent, visible & external means.
  • Work-Life Balance ⚖️ - 15 days of Privilege leaves per calendar year, 6 days of Paid Sick leave per calendar year, 6 days of Casual leave per calendar year. Paid 26 weeks of Maternity leaves, 1 week of Paternity leave, a day off on your Birthday, and paid holidays
  • Financial Security 💰 - Provident Fund & Gratuity
  • Wellness 🤸‍ - Employee Assistance Program and comprehensive wellness initiatives
  • Growth 🌱 - Access to ongoing learning and development opportunities and career advancement

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
JavaSpringbootMicroservicesRESTful web applicationsSQLMySQLPostgresRedisAgileDevOps
Soft skills
problem-solvingdebuggingcommunicationcollaborationmentoringprocess improvementcode reviewconstructive feedback
ConnectWise

Senior Software Engineer I – Backend, .NET

ConnectWise
Seniorfull-time🇮🇳 India
Posted: 6 days agoSource: boards.greenhouse.io
ASP.NETAWSCloudMicroservices.NETNoSQLSQL